Output 15286bb575278d83a4e3eddb6295f7075c8aaefffacc09cbe51c355d146b5e93:159

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b4a15e985fc2e96953cc77855db397878d53b3aa121dbbc0d12ebcf96837b00
address
bc1ptd9pt6v9lshfd9fucau9tkee0pud2we65ysah0qdzt4ul95r0vqqaem0e8
transaction
15286bb575278d83a4e3eddb6295f7075c8aaefffacc09cbe51c355d146b5e93
confirmations
5050
spent
true